Disposing the Batteries
WARNING
This product contains lithium-ion rechargeable batteries. According to Federal and State regulations,
removal and proper disposal of lithium-ion batteries is required. For removal of the batteries in your
Adapt™ Ion Pet, see instructions on this page.
NOTICE
Disconnecting the battery will destroy the appliance and void the warranty.

Disconnect and remove entire battery assembly by
unplugging the two sockets (one red, one white) from
the vacuum.
NOTE: Keep Battery Pack together – DO NOT separate individual batteries. For specific
disposal instructions of batteries, please contact the RBRC (Rechargeable Battery
Recycling Corporation) at 1-800-822-8837 or visit www.call2recycle.org.
